Output 66aba55691e8f7872554f1967b14630d47b404574df37789f43a528cae4090eb:0

value
8864000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6128e0c4c3940afb29429782ef9162ed31d90e4e OP_EQUAL
address
3AYkSQRg3TB1wyYnJzgvgcy3DTA2tjxn5e
transaction
66aba55691e8f7872554f1967b14630d47b404574df37789f43a528cae4090eb
spent
true